AIM: It is to investigate that recombinant human interleukine-13(rhIL-13) mediates expression of proto-oncogene c-fos and its effect on the differentiation of megakaryocytic cell line, Dami cell, and provide the experiment and theory evidence for the clinical practice of IL-13. METHODS: 1.Effect of rhIL-13 on the growth of Dami cells was measured by means of Dami cell proliferation experiments including diagram of curves on the growth of Dami cells and MTT. 2. After 1×109/L Dami cells serum-starved for 20h, total RNA was extracted from those cells treated by rhIL-13 separately for 30 or 60 min or 5 generations. The RNA quality was measured by means of RNA agar gel electrophoresis. 3. Reverse transcription polymerase chain reaction (RT-PCR) was used to observe the expression of some genes including that:(1)the expression of IL-13 receptorα1 chain(IL-13Rα1) in Dami cells;(2)the expression of c-fos gene in Dami cells treated for 30min or 60min by rhIL-13;(3)the expression of GPIIb and Glycophorin A(GPA) genes in Dami cells treated for 5 generations by rhIL-13. 4. After Dami cells serum-starved for 20h, Dami cells were treated by rhIL-13 for 30 min and RIPA Buffer was used for Dami cells lysis. The change of c-fos protein expression was observed by Western Blotting. RESULTS: 1.The expression of IL-13 Rα1 is detected in Dami cells by RT-PCR. 2.The c-fos mRNA expression were observed in rhIL-13 treated group(100ug/L),serum treated group(15%serum) and mixture treated group (100ug/LrhIL-13+15%serum) after Dami cells treated for 30 min,while c-fos mRNA expression disappears in rhIL-13 treated group and mixture treated group after 60 min except serum treated group.3.RhIL-13 up-regulates the expression of GPIIb, a megaKaryoc- ytic`s surface marker, in Dami cells treated by rhIL-13 for 5 generations. 4. RhIL-13 up-regulates the expression of GPA gene in Dami cells treated by rhIL-13 for 5 generations. 5. In contrast to the blank control group,the expression of c-fos protein is obviously enhanced in rhIL-13 treated group,serum treated group and mixture treated group after Dami cells treated for 30 min. 6.The result of MTT shows no dominant difference between the control group and rhIL-13 treated group,which indicates that rhIL-13 has no positive effect on the proliferation of Dami cells(P>0.05). CONCLUSION: 1. Dami cells express IL-13 receptor α1. 2.RhIL-13 induces c-fos mRNA and protein expressions in Dami cells. 3.RhIL-13 up-regulates the mRNA expressions of GPA and GPIIb.4. RhIL-13 hardly exerts dominantly positive effect on the proliferation of Dami cells.
